Oracle SQLでゼロ(0)やスペース埋めする方法です。Oracle SQLでのゼロやスペース埋めするにはいくつか方法があります。一言でゼロやスペース埋めたいといっても、文字列の先頭を埋めたい場合、文字列の後ろをそろえたい場合、数値をゼロ埋めしたい場合など、状況によって様々です。 oracle 文字列 LPAD RPAD ゼロ埋め.
文字列中の一部の文字取得 位置と文字数を指定して取得する 文字列中の文字を、文字数で指定して取得するには、SUBSTRを ... [Oracle] 文字列関数 空白の削除SQL(TRIM) 2019年11月8日 ゆるゆる社内SE.
シェアする.
初心者エンジニアのための備忘録. REGEXP_COUNT 関数:文字列 string 中の検索開始位置 position から 正規表現パターン文字列 pattern で検索し、その正規表現にマッチした文字列が合計で何個存在したかを戻す。 Oracle® 非公式 SQL, PL/SQL & DBA's リファレンス . SQL Serverでは、varcharはバイト数、nvarcharは文字数を指定するものとしてデータ型自体が分けられています。また、Oracleでは、varchar2はバイト数指定になります。varchar2(10)なら、10バイトの文字列が格納できるんですね。
文字列. WEBサイトをフォローする. char(10)の列に全角10文字を格納し、長さとバイト数を確認。 LENGTH、LENGTHB 関数:LENGTH 文字列の文字数を戻す。文字列 string が char 型(⇔VARCHAR2型)の場合には自動的に補完される後続のスペースも長さとしてカウントされる。LENGTHB 文字列 string のバイト数を戻す。全角文字の場合には使用しているキャラクタセットによりバイト数は異なる。 Oracleマスター. Twitter Facebook はてブ Pocket LINE コピー. 一方、PostgreSQLでchar(10)と設定した場合は、10文字格納出来る。 ora2pgやSCT(schema conversion tool)ではこの非互換は変換されないので注意が必要。 Oracle/PostgreSQL共通 create table chartest(a char(10)); PostgreSQL. REGEXP_COUNT. 以上、Oracleで文字列でうめるRPAD・LPAD(ゼロ埋め)でした。 文字列. Oracle初心者でもスッキリわかる. oracleで文字列を切り取りするには、「substr」「substrb」を使います。 substr(文字列, 開始桁, 切り取り文字数) 文字列の指定桁数から指定文字数を切り取ります; substrb(文字列, 開始桁, 切り取りバイト数) 文字列の指定桁数から指定バイトを切り取ります
関連記事 .